Very nice garage. What size garage doors did you go with?
Ceiling height? Did you use attic trusses?

Thanks

I used 2 16x8 doors, finished ceiling height should be about 11ft. I wanted the attic trusses but just couldnt justify the cost. They were over 110 dollars more apiece(24 of them). When I worked it all out between subfloor for the attic, truss cost and things like the stairs. I would have been well over 3500 to 4000 dollars. I also have an attached oversize 2 car garage if they are both full I have to much junk!!! Just didnt think it was worth the cost. I can build a seperate pole barn for that kind of money.
